What Is AI Fraud Detection Software?

AI fraud detection software uses machine learning algorithms, behavioral analytics, deep learning, and predictive modeling to identify fraudulent transactions automatically.

Unlike traditional systems that rely only on predefined rules, AI continuously learns from transaction patterns and customer behavior to detect anomalies instantly.

Examples include:

  • Credit card fraud
  • Account takeover attacks
  • Identity theft
  • Loan application fraud
  • Payment fraud
  • Wire transfer fraud
  • Digital banking fraud
  • Money laundering detection

Benefits of AI Fraud Detection Software

1. Real-Time Fraud Detection

AI monitors transactions instantly and blocks suspicious activities before money leaves an account.


2. Lower False Positives

Traditional systems often flag legitimate transactions.

Machine learning improves accuracy by understanding customer spending behavior.


3. Continuous Learning

AI models become smarter with every transaction, adapting to new fraud techniques automatically.


4. Improved Customer Experience

Customers experience fewer unnecessary transaction declines while remaining protected.

AI Technologies Used in Banking Fraud Detection

Modern platforms combine multiple AI technologies:

Machine Learning

Learns from millions of historical transactions.

Deep Learning

Recognizes complex fraud patterns.

Behavioral Analytics

Studies customer spending habits.

Natural Language Processing (NLP)

Analyzes emails, chats, and fraud reports.

Graph Analytics

Identifies fraud rings and criminal networks.

Predictive Analytics

Forecasts future fraud attempts.


How AI Detects Fraud

The AI process typically includes:

  1. Collect transaction data
  2. Analyze customer behavior
  3. Compare with historical records
  4. Assign a fraud risk score
  5. Flag suspicious transactions
  6. Block or verify high-risk activities
  7. Learn from investigation outcomes

Challenges of AI Fraud Detection

Although AI is highly effective, banks should consider:

  • High implementation costs
  • Data privacy concerns
  • Need for quality training data
  • Regulatory compliance requirements
  • Model maintenance
  • Integration with legacy banking systems

Proper governance and regular model updates are essential for long-term success.

Best Practices for Banks

To maximize the effectiveness of AI fraud detection:

  • Combine AI with human expertise.
  • Continuously retrain AI models with fresh data.
  • Use multi-factor authentication (MFA).
  • Monitor all banking channels, including mobile, web, ATM, and card payments.
  • Conduct regular security audits and penetration testing.
  • Educate customers about phishing and social engineering.
  • Integrate AI with AML and KYC systems for a comprehensive risk management strategy.
